Output d9052e88ebb9727d416cf310adbdbf173b97d0271a20f5c53c23f1419d4dfe1f:22

value
7519000
script pubkey
OP_0 OP_PUSHBYTES_20 15b8772d28593a00bc976faead66f43537aab28a
address
bc1qzku8wtfgtyaqp0yhd7h26eh5x5m64v52ty75hk
transaction
d9052e88ebb9727d416cf310adbdbf173b97d0271a20f5c53c23f1419d4dfe1f
confirmations
149401
spent
true